En esta guía para desarrolladores, se describe cómo medir las interacciones en redes sociales con el SDK de Google Analytics para Android versión 3.
Descripción general
La medición de interacciones sociales te permite medir las interacciones de un usuario con varios widgets de recomendaciones y uso compartido de redes sociales incorporados en tu contenido.
Las interacciones en redes sociales tienen los siguientes campos:
Nombre del campo | Monitor de campo | Tipo | Obligatorio | Descripción |
---|---|---|---|---|
Red social | Fields.SOCIAL_NETWORK
|
String
|
Sí | Es la red social con la que interactúa el usuario (p. ej., Facebook, Google+, Twitter, etcétera). |
Acción social | Fields.SOCIAL_ACTION
|
String
|
Sí | Indica la acción social realizada (p. ej., marcar “me gusta”, compartir, hacer +1, etcétera). |
Objetivo de la acción social | Fields.SOCIAL_TARGET
|
String
|
No | Es el contenido en el que se realiza la acción social (es decir, un artículo o video específico). |
Actualmente, los datos de interacción en redes sociales que recopila el SDK de Google Analytics para Android v3.x están disponibles a través de informes personalizados y la API de Core Reporting.
Implementación
Para enviar una interacción en redes sociales a Google Analytics, usa
MapBuilder.createSocial()
como en el siguiente ejemplo:
// May return null if EasyTracker has not already been initialized with a // property ID. Tracker easyTracker = EasyTracker.getInstance(this); easyTracker.send(MapBuilder .createSocial("Twitter", // Social network (required) "Tweet", // Social action (required) "https://developers.google.com/analytics") // Social target .build() );